The established leaders in manned guarding

Nigeria has a mature private-security industry, dominated by large manpower firms.

Halogen Group (Halogen Security). Founded in 1992, Halogen is one of West Africa’s largest security firms, employing around 20,000 people and offering integrated manpower-and-technology services across banking, retail and industry.

G4S Nigeria. Now part of Allied Universal, G4S has operated in Nigeria for over 40 years and is known for manned guarding, cash-in-transit and secure logistics built on global standards.

Bemil Nigeria. With almost five decades of operation, Bemil offers manned guarding, cash-in-transit, K9 units, electronic security and consultancy across oil and gas, banking and government.

Others, including Kings Guards, Proton and Sheriff Deputies, compete strongly in traditional guarding. If your need is a large, uniformed guard force, these are serious, credible options.
